1.1 root 1: .TH SCANDIR 3 "19 January 1983"
2: .UC 4
3: .SH NAME
4: scandir \- scan a directory
5: .SH SYNOPSIS
6: .nf
7: .B #include <sys/types.h>
8: .B #include <sys/dir.h>
9: .PP
10: .B scandir(dirname, namelist, select, compar)
11: .B char *dirname;
12: .B struct direct *(*namelist[]);
13: .B int (*select)();
14: .B int (*compar)();
15: .PP
16: .B alphasort(d1, d2)
17: .B struct direct **d1, **d2;
18: .fi
19: .SH DESCRIPTION
20: .I Scandir
21: reads the directory
22: .I dirname
23: and builds an array of pointers to directory
24: entries using
25: .IR malloc (3).
26: It returns the number of entries in the array and a pointer to the
27: array through
28: .IR namelist .
29: .PP
30: The
31: .I select
32: parameter is a pointer to a user supplied subroutine which is called by
33: .I scandir
34: to select which entries are to be included in the array.
35: The select routine is passed a
36: pointer to a directory entry and should return a non-zero
37: value if the directory entry is to be included in the array.
38: If
39: .I select
40: is null, then all the directory entries will be included.
41: .PP
42: The
43: .I compar
44: parameter is a pointer to a user supplied subroutine which is passed to
45: .IR qsort (3)
46: to sort the completed array. If this pointer is null, the array is not sorted.
47: .I Alphasort
48: is a routine which can be used for the
49: .I compar
50: parameter to sort the array alphabetically.
51: .PP
52: The memory allocated for the array can be deallocated with
53: .I free
54: (see
55: .IR malloc (3))
56: by freeing each pointer in the array and the array itself.
57: .SH "SEE ALSO"
58: directory(3),
59: malloc(3),
60: qsort(3),
61: dir(5)
62: .SH DIAGNOSTICS
63: Returns \-1 if the directory cannot be opened for reading or if
64: .IR malloc (3)
65: cannot allocate enough memory to hold all the data structures.
